Oh how I wish I had found this site earlier!!! DLC are frightening. They have a final charging order over my property for some debts I haven't been able to work out. I never received any court papers and didn't know what was happening until I received a letter from the Land Registry - I sent a defence letter to the court but DLC were awarded the FCO. Earlier in the year they sent a postcard to my son's address (he lives 50 miles away) addresses to me and asking to phone the number on the card. He had just got married and his new wife had a fit!! At no time have I ever given his address to anyone!! I complained to the OFT and sent a letter to DLC chief executive - I received a letter from them apologising for the mistake and confirming I didn't owe any money to them. Next thing I know there's court proceedings and a FCO. I was so distressed at the time I just agreed to pay them £30 a month which I can't really afford. I've heard since that they can come back and ask for increased payments - this is keeping me awake at night!!! Is there anything I can do?

Now I'm no expert but I do have an FCO on my property. I was extremely naive at the time and did not challenge anything in court - I found out 2 years later than I should have been paying £150 a month by order of the court after the FCO was granted (only found this out when I was contacted by a Debt Collection Agency (DCA) However, I filled in an N245 form with the court (it cost me £35 at the time) which basically tells the court what you can reasonably afford to pay each month - and it was accepted (payments being reduced to £10 per month)

 

Just looking at what you have posted - could you give us some more info on the debts ie were they credit cards, secured loans etc? You have also said that you received a letter from the DLC Chief Executive apologising for the mistake and stating that you didn't owe any money to them? - can you give us more info? Presumably you had already received a CCJ?

 

Even if DLC do try to take you to court to increase the payments, the court would only ask you to pay what you can reasonably afford - so I wouldn't worry on that score.
